Abstract

The practical focuses on the flora and vegetation of the colline and montane belts in Valais. Students are offered guided field excursions to deepen their knowledge of plant species and to learn to recognise important vegetation units and their ecological characteristics.

Objective

Becoming acquainted with the flora and ecological conditions of important vegetation units of the colline and montane belts of the canton Valais. Consolidation of taxonomic and plant morphological knowledge. Gain experience in plant determination using scientific determination keys and the creation of a herbarium.

Content

This course gives an introduction to the flora and vegetation of the colline and montane belts in Valais. During three day excursions the participants will become acquainted with important vegetation types, their species diversity and the respective environmental conditions in the botanically famous area known as Follatères, between Branson and Saillon. Besides deepening the knowledge of plant species, plant families and vegetation, a focus will be laid on how man shaped (and continues to shape) the cultural landscape. Students will further learn the basic techniques to create a herbarium.
